analyze emerging trends in laser cutting technology and discuss ethical considerations related to its use Analysis of Current Trends in Laser Cutting Technology Laser cutting technology is rapidly evolving driven by advancements in laser sources cutting heads and automation Here are some prominent trends shaping the industry Fiber Lasers These lasers offer high power density efficiency and long lifespan making them ideal for highspeed and highprecision cutting of various materials Automated Systems Integration with robotics and automated material handling systems is increasing efficiency and reducing human intervention particularly in largescale production environments Smart Manufacturing Data analytics and machine learning are being used to optimize cutting parameters predict maintenance needs and improve overall process efficiency Additive Manufacturing Integration Combining laser cutting with additive manufacturing 3D printing allows for creating complex parts with intricate geometries and multimaterial designs Material Innovation Laser cutting is being used to process new and advanced materials such as composites ceramics and titanium opening up possibilities in various Laser Cutting Machine Manual Your Comprehensive Guide The Amada laser cutting machine manual is an essential resource for anyone operating or maintaining this powerful equipment It provides comprehensive information on 1 Safety Procedures Understanding Laser Hazards The manual details the potential hazards associated with laser cutting including eye and skin damage fire risks and potential for hazardous fumes Personal Protective Equipment PPE The manual specifies the necessary PPE such as safety glasses protective gloves and respiratory masks to ensure operator safety Emergency Procedures The manual provides detailed instructions on how to respond to emergencies including power shutoff procedures firstaid protocols and contacting relevant authorities 2 Machine Operation Machine Setup and Calibration The manual outlines the steps involved in setting up the machine including installing cutting tools adjusting laser focus and calibrating the cutting head Operating Controls and Interface The manual explains the functions of the control panel buttons and software interface enabling users to program cutting paths set parameters and monitor machine operation 3 Material Handling and Loading The manual provides guidelines on safely handling and loading materials into the machine ensuring proper alignment and stability 3 Maintenance and Troubleshooting Preventive Maintenance The manual recommends regular maintenance tasks such as cleaning optical components checking laser power output and lubricating moving parts to ensure optimal performance and minimize downtime Troubleshooting Common Issues The manual provides a comprehensive troubleshooting guide addressing common problems such as cutting errors machine alarms and software glitches It offers solutions and corrective actions for each issue Spare Parts and Repair The manual includes information on ordering spare parts contacting authorized service providers and accessing technical support resources 4 Optimization and Efficiency Cutting Parameter Optimization The manual provides guidelines on selecting the appropriate cutting parameters including laser power cutting speed gas pressure and focus distance to achieve optimal cutting quality and efficiency Material Database and Applications The manual may include a database of recommended cutting parameters for various materials allowing for efficient setup and optimized results Process Monitoring and Data Analysis The manual may guide users on how to utilize the machines data logging capabilities to monitor
